You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Laramie County Community College. The school came in at #1 for the Best Vallue Accounting Schools in Wyoming For Those Making Over $110k. Located in Cheyenne, Wyoming, this small public school awarded 25 degrees to qualified ’s accounting students in 2019-2020.

As a testament to the quality of education offered at LCCC, the school also landed the #2 spot in our “Best Accounting Schools in Wyoming” ranking. The yearly cost to attend Laramie County Community College is $5,862 for Wyoming Accounting students whose families make more than $110k.

University of Wyoming

Laramie, Wyoming

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end University of Wyoming. The school came in at #2 for the Best Vallue Accounting Schools in Wyoming For Those Making Over $110k. This fairly large school is located in Laramie, Wyoming, and it awarded 67 ’s accounting degrees in 2019-2020.

UW also took the #1 spot in our “Best Accounting Schools in Wyoming” ranking. It costs about $12,159 for Wyoming Accounting students whose families make more than $110k per year to attend UW.

The student loan default rate at the school is 4.5%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.
